Study finds high school journalism leading the way in financial literacy, even if business isn't part of curriculum
Journalism classes usually are not paired with business lessons. While there have been calls for increasing business knowledge in journalism, research from the University of Kansas has found that high school journalists are learning business skills even though they are not a core part of the curriculum.
